Former Chief Minister BS Yediyurappa on Friday urged the state government to declare the drought-hit taluks and start relief work immediately, exerting pressure on the Congress regime as soaring temperature combined with failure of monsoon has pushed farmers into hardship.

The veteran BJP leader said there was a drought situation in more than 120 taluks, or about half the state, as most reservoirs are empty, and farmers are facing a distress. I demand that the state government should not delay any more and immediately declare the drought affected areas, give compensation to the farmers and carry out drought relief works,” he posted on X.

According to the data released by the Karnataka State Natural Disaster Monitoring Centre on Friday, out of 31 districts in the state, 18 districts have had deficit rainfall while it is normal in 13 districts. Three fourths of the state had no rainfall for 24 hours from Thursday morning.


The former CM and BJP have been putting pressure on the Siddaramaiah regime just when the government is tapping all possible sources of revenues to fund the programmes announced based on the five election guarantees. The overwhelming response to the schemes has increased the budget expenditure on these schemes, derailing other conventional programmes.

On Thursday, Bengaluru MP Tejasvi Surya attacked the government saying that the state had released 10 tmc ft of water to Tamil Nadu when the state had faced 42% deficit in rainfall this monsoon.

With funds shortage biting the government, the CM wrote to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man, last week, urging her to release special grants and state-specific grants worth Rs 11,000 as recommended by the 15th Finance Commission.
